General Information
Name: Skarn
Class: Beast
Type: Domestic
Threat Level: 1
Size: Large
Height: 1.6 m
Description: The Skarn is an agile, long-limbed quadruped expertly bred for incredible speed and endurance in the unforgiving landscapes of Keldrath. Its sleek hide stretches tightly over powerful muscles, displaying hues of dusty grey and dry-bone tan, often darkened by sweat and the grime of relentless travels. With a narrow, lizard-like face, this creature features nostrils that seal against swirling dust and a forked tongue that flickers to detect subtle shifts in wind and warmth. While it lacks scales, the Skarn's skin possesses a dry, reptilian sheen and is adorned along its flanks with short keratinous ridges that stiffen in moments of stress or excitement. Rather than serving as a defense mechanism, these growths act as primal indicators of its emotional state. Its deep-set, slitted eyes remain unblinking—perfectly adapted for the sun-bleached roads and expansive plains it traverses. Equipped with long, padded feet, the Skarn boasts three toes for males and four for females, each ending in blunt claws optimized for traction over gravel, scree, and crumbling ruin-stone. Its strong, muscular tail not only aids in balance during rapid maneuvers but also allows for swift navigation across the most challenging terrains. The Skarn is truly a marvel of evolution, uniquely designed to thrive in the harshest conditions.
Behaviour: The Skarn is a remarkably docile and obedient creature, yet it possesses an unsettling silence. Instead of the typical vocalizations of whinnies or calls, it communicates through deep throat clicks and expressive postures—arching its spine or stiffening its tail to convey its feelings. The bond between the Skarn and its rider is forged through a sacred ritual known as "first saddle," which unfolds over several days. During this time, the rider builds a relationship with the Skarn while crafting a saddle tailored to its unique shape and the arrangement of its loin ridges. Once the saddle is completed, the rider undertakes a momentous journey to Nagithel, just an hour's ride from Endring. Here, the bond is solidified as they share water from the sacred lake. The Skarn recognizes its bonded master through scent and tone. In moments of fear, the Skarn instinctively bolts towards the open ground with deliberate speed, shunning confinement and expressing a dislike for stone walls. However, with gentle handling and patience, it can be taught to navigate ruins and underground paths, revealing its potential beyond initial apprehensions.
Handling: Keep lightly burdened to maintain speed and stamina. Avoid prolonged confinement or sudden sounds, which can cause stress responses. Ideal conditions include open terrain, light breeze, and wide sightlines. Feeds on dry Sunbulb leaves and Rimeleek vines; drinks sparingly. Comes towards the master's whistle.
